Jose Mourinho keen to bring Nemanja Matic to Old Trafford
MANCHESTER UNITED are pursuing their interest in Chelsea midfielder Nemanja Matic, according to reports. Jose Mourinho is keen to bring in a host of fresh talent in the transfer window and Express Sport understands the Portuguese is being handed £200million to spend. The 53-year-old has been linked with trying to raid his former club Chelsea in recent months. And according to Italian publication GianlucaDiMarzio , Matic is at the forefront of his plans. Matic was a key part of Chelsea 's title-winning campaign in the 2014/15 season but struggled to maintain a regular starting spot under Guus Hiddink last season. Pep Guardiola’s Manchester City to play Bayern Munich in a preseason friendly
Pep Guardiola will return to Munich with Manchester City for a friendly on July 20, the first match at home for Bayern coach Carlo Ancelotti. Guardiola led Bayern to three straight Bundesliga titles in his three seasons in Munich before moving on to Manchester City. The Bayern squad starts preparing for the new season under Ancelotti on July 11, but without Bayern players who are at the European Championship in France.
